Class: FakeMouseEvent
Defined in: packages/dom-core/src/fakeEvents/FakeMouseEvent.ts:9
Internal
Fake mouse event used internally by DOMInteractor to synthesize positioned
mouse events in jsdom. Exported for cross-package reuse within the monorepo,
not part of the stable 1.0 consumer API.

cancelBubble​
cancelBubble:
boolean
Defined in: node_modules/.pnpm/typescript@6.0.3/node_modules/typescript/lib/lib.dom.d.ts:14171
The cancelBubble property of the Event interface is deprecated. Use Event.stopPropagation() instead. Setting its value to true before returning from an event handler prevents propagation of the event. In later implementations, setting this to false does nothing. See Browser compatibility for details.

isTrusted​
readonlyisTrusted:boolean
Defined in: node_modules/.pnpm/typescript@6.0.3/node_modules/typescript/lib/lib.dom.d.ts:14207
The isTrusted read-only property of the Event interface is a boolean value that is true when the event was generated by the user agent (including via user actions and programmatic methods such as HTMLElement.focus()), and false when the event was dispatched via EventTarget.dispatchEvent(). The only exception is the click event, which initializes the isTrusted property to false in user agents.

stopPropagation()​
Call Signature​
stopPropagation():
void
Defined in: node_modules/.pnpm/typescript@6.0.3/node_modules/typescript/lib/lib.dom.d.ts:14270
The stopPropagation() method of the Event interface prevents further propagation of the current event in the capturing and bubbling phases. It does not, however, prevent any default behaviors from occurring; for instance, clicks on links are still processed. If you want to stop those behaviors, see the preventDefault() method. It also does not prevent propagation to other event-handlers of the current element. If you want to stop those, see stopImmediatePropagation().
